What is Indigo Crystal (2023) about?
*Indigo Crystal* follows Vuk, a former convict haunted by his best friend's suicide, as he fights to save his younger brother Zizi from a life of crime. The film blends crime, drama, and emotional depth, exploring themes of guilt, brotherhood, and the search for redemption in a world that's stacked against him.
Who directed Indigo Crystal?
Luka 'Ludi' Mihailović is at the helm of *Indigo Crystal (2023)*, bringing his signature intensity to this gripping crime drama.
Who stars in Indigo Crystal?
The film stars Miodrag Radonjić as Vuk, with Nina Janković, Miloš Petrović 'Trojpec,' Denis Murić, and Relja 'Seksi' Despotović rounding out the core cast in pivotal roles.

How long is Indigo Crystal?
*Indigo Crystal (2023)* runs for 105 minutes, packing its emotional and action-packed narrative into a tight, engaging runtime.
